Transaction 30f538fe3795d7d3d606d42ea9737f5e1f4c43070566092ca78bee94b857c8ae
1 Input
1 Output
-
30f538fe3795d7d3d606d42ea9737f5e1f4c43070566092ca78bee94b857c8ae:0
- value
- 721382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fb737e80043760e21a69f15bf6058ae5e5d9f8c OP_EQUAL
- address
- 34aiMj7p6x2XdMdvDqsmCXCdiHK8DbE2bk